Customer Engagement Manager jobs

• The average pay for Customer Engagement Manager jobs is $123K per year.
• Entry-level positions start at $90K per year, while the most experienced workers can earn up to $210K per year.
33 companies are currently advertising Customer Engagement Manager jobs including Michael Page, Six Degrees Executive, Australia Post, KPMG and Amazon.
• Top skills include CUSTOMER ENGAGEMENT, MARKETING, PROJECT MANAGEMENT, OPERATIONS and RETAIL MARKETING.
